Exactly, which is why I feel so bad he never earned a title. At his peak he was a giant amongst men, in an era when there was a full on titan. Hell, he finished on the podium in all but one event in 2009 and lost the title by a single point simply because his hood latch broke during the final rally and the minute he lost removing the hood bumped him from leading the rally to finishing second. No one else ever got that close to Loeb. I did the math once, and if you were to count every time he beat everyone but Loeb as a win he'd have 34 career wins and four titles. More than anyone except Loeb.

Yes, but Gronholm only got within a point because Loeb missed the final four events, whereas Mikko got within a point on his own merit. Even though Gronholm finished the season within a point of Loeb, Loeb had the title won at the end of Rally Australia, with two rounds left in the bag.
And this is not meant at all to discredit Solberg, who absolutely deserved his title, or to offend a proud Norwegian, whom I greatly respect, but one could argue that Loeb wasn't yet fully matured in 2003, as that was his first full season in the series.

That's true, but Marcus still got as close as Mikko. And who knows what might had happened if Loeb didn't break his arm.
And though 2003 was his first full season, Loeb had driven several events in 2002 as well, winning one and getting his win taken away in another. He also won the JWRC Championship in 2001. You could argue that is was Citroen's first full season as well, and that Subaru had more experience and a championship-winning car. Still I think that those cars were level at that point, since Citroen had been testing the Xsara for years, first as a kit car and then as a WRC car.
